How Does Adverse Weather Affect Runway Conditions?

Adverse weather conditions, such as heavy rain, snow, ice, fog, and strong winds, can significantly impact runway conditions, leading to potential hazards for aircraft during takeoff and landing. These conditions can reduce runway friction, decrease visibility, and increase the risk of hydroplaning or skidding.

What Are the Minimum Weather Requirements for Takeoff and Landing?

The Federal Aviation Administration (FAA) sets specific weather minimums for Visual Flight Rules (VFR) operations:

  • Daytime Operations: A minimum ceiling of 1,000 feet and visibility of at least one mile.

  • Nighttime Operations: A minimum ceiling of 1,000 feet and visibility of at least two miles.

These minimums ensure that pilots have sufficient visibility and cloud clearance to operate safely under VFR. (law.cornell.edu)

How Do Pilots Navigate Adverse Weather Conditions?

Pilots employ several strategies to navigate adverse weather conditions:

  • Pre-Flight Planning: Reviewing weather forecasts and runway conditions to anticipate potential challenges.

  • Aircraft Performance Considerations: Understanding how weather affects aircraft performance, such as reduced engine output in hot temperatures or increased runway length requirements in high humidity.

  • In-Flight Adjustments: Utilizing instruments and autopilot systems to maintain control during turbulent conditions.

  • Communication with Air Traffic Control (ATC): Coordinating with ATC for updated weather information and potential rerouting.

What Are the Challenges of Flying in Adverse Weather?

Flying in adverse weather presents several challenges:

  • Reduced Visibility: Fog, heavy rain, or snow can decrease visibility, making it difficult for pilots to see the runway during takeoff and landing.

  • Runway Contamination: Snow, ice, or standing water can contaminate runways, reducing friction and increasing the risk of skidding.

  • Aircraft Icing: Ice accumulation on aircraft surfaces can affect aerodynamics and control.

  • Turbulence and Wind Shear: Strong winds and turbulence can affect aircraft stability and control.
